2016 PKR to TND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2016

During 2016, the PKR to TND ex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 27, valuing the pair at 0.0223.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 2, dropping to 0.0190.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0033 TND.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0195 to the December average rate of 0.0220, the exchange rate registered a net change of 13.21%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2016 high of 0.0223 was up 13.75% compared to the 2015 peak of 0.0196,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
